#e5d3d2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e5d3d2 is composed of 89.8% red, 82.7%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 7.9% magenta, 8.3%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 3.2 degrees, a saturation of 26.8% and a lightness of 86.1%. #e5d3d2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#cba7a5.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#e5d3d2 color description : Light grayish red.
#e5d3d2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e5d3d2 has RGB values of R:229, G:211, B:210 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.08, Y:0.08,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15061970.
